Назад | Перейти на главную страницу

Мониторинг операторов SQL в DB2

Мне нужно отслеживать операторы SQL, отправленные в базу данных DB2. Я нашел следующую статью http://www.dba-db2.com/2010/01/trace-sql-statements-in-db2-database.html и я действительно могу записывать операторы SQL.

Проблема в том, что подготовленные операторы SQL все еще содержат вопросительные знаки. Есть ли способ получить окончательную версию операторов SQL?

Версия DB2: 10.1.3

Спасибо

Я думаю, что нашел решение http://db2commerce.com/2013/12/03/using-an-event-monitor-to-capture-statements-with-values-for-parameter-markers/ (эта ссылка больше не работает. Используйте archive.org - см. комментарии).

В моем случае мне пришлось изменить пользователя запроса, имена таблиц (чтобы они соответствовали имени моего монитора событий) и удалить условие «where as.UOW_ID = 27».